Yen Soars on Speculation of Early BOJ Rate Hike

The Japanese yen has reached its strongest point against the US dollar since February, surging more than 2% in just one week.

This significant jump comes as traders anticipate that the Bank of Japan might raise interest rates sooner than expected, causing the US dollar to decline by 1.14% against the yen.

Currency analyst Lee Hardman from MUFG notes that breaking past a major level of 155 per dollar has given the yen even more momentum, suggesting it could continue rising.
